The Opportunity:
As an IT Support Technician, you will provide essential 1st and 2nd line support for Servers, Network, Computing, and AV systems. You will work closely with the Data and Project Team to deliver bespoke application support and ensure project tasks are completed on time. This role is ideal for someone who thrives in a dynamic, technology-driven environment.
Key Responsibilities:
- Provide 1st and 2nd line IT support for Servers, Network, Computing, and AV systems.
- Collaborate with the Data and Project Team to deliver bespoke application support.
- Ensure timely completion of project tasks and deliverables.
- Troubleshoot and resolve technical issues efficiently.
- Maintain and update IT systems to ensure optimal performance.
- Communicate effectively with users and stakeholders to understand and resolve technical needs.
- Document all support activities and system changes for future reference.
- Stay up to date with emerging IT trends and technologies to enhance service delivery.
Qualifications & Skills:
Required
- Full UK driving license (required for travel between schools).
- Right to work in the UK (no sponsorship available).
- Proven experience in IT support, preferably in an educational setting.
- Strong technical knowledge of Servers, Network, Computing, and AV systems.
- Excellent problem-solving and communication skills.
